Legal Counsel - Luxury Hospitality

Elevate your legal career as a Legal Counsel at Accor in Dubai, where you will provide comprehensive legal support to the Luxury & Lifestyle business units in the Middle East and Africa (MEA) region. In this role, you will collaborate closely with the legal team and business partners to guide and fulfill their legal needs across corporate, operations, procurement, development, and legal administration functions. This position offers a unique opportunity to work with prestigious luxury brands in a dynamic and innovative hospitality environment.

Job Location: Dubai, United Arab Emirates
Job Type: Full-Time
Job Industry: Hospitality – Luxury Lifestyle
Job Function: Legal and Corporate Affairs
Salary: Negotiable
Gender: Any

Key Responsibilities:

Contract Management and Negotiation:
- Create and update development templates for agreements, including Hotel Management, Consultancy Services, Franchise, Brand Licensing, Master Services, Residential Management, Rental Services, and Residence Owner Services.
- Assist in negotiating property development deals with owners and drafting initial development agreements.
- Develop operational template agreements for marketing, services, procurement, and employment-related matters.
- Review and approve template agreements submitted by business units, especially those under EUR 50,000.

Legal Advisory and Support:
- Provide legal support in negotiations, disputes, and risk management for business units across the MEA region.
- Conduct legal research and prepare advice/position papers on relevant legal issues across multiple jurisdictions.
- Assist in the development and implementation of legal policies and procedures for the MEA region.
- Provide strategic legal advice on risk management and Hotel Management Agreement (HMA) interpretations.

Training and System Management:
- Prepare and conduct training sessions, create legal guides, and deliver presentations to assist business units in their day-to-day operations.
- Manage and update the Agiloft system with new agreements, amendments, and supplemental correspondences.
- Train business units on using the Agiloft system for legal documentation and compliance.

Corporate Secretarial and External Liaison:
- Support the corporate secretarial function for luxury companies in the region.
- Liaise with external counsel on assigned legal matters and manage legal expenditures.

Risk Assessment and Compliance:
- Stay up-to-date on legal developments in the MEA region and identify potential legal risks for the company.
- Provide proactive advice on compliance, risk management, and legal interpretations to ensure legal protection and brand integrity.

Requirements:

Education and Experience:
- Common Law qualification (US, Canada, UK, Singapore, Australia, or similar).
- 2-6 years of post-qualification experience, preferably within the region.
- Background in hospitality with exposure to core hotel management documents is an advantage.
- Commercial experience in drafting, negotiating, and resolving contract disputes.
- Expertise in Corporate Law, Employment Law, or Procurement.
- Proficiency in risk assessment and strategic legal advisory.
- Experience in working with luxury lifestyle brands or international hospitality is a plus.

Competencies:
- Excellent communication skills with the ability to effectively engage stakeholders across luxury brands.
- Strong negotiation skills and sound judgment in legal and commercial matters.
- Adaptability and resilience with the flexibility to learn quickly and adapt to changing environments.
- Independent and efficient work ethic with the ability to manage competing deadlines.
- Professionalism and interpersonal skills to foster effective working relationships.
- Proficiency in a second language, preferably Arabic.
- Cultural awareness with an understanding of MEA culture and business dynamics.
- Innovative mindset with a proactive, positive disruptor mentality, proposing legal solutions rather than just identifying risks.

What We Offer:
- Competitive salary package with performance-based incentives.
- Employee benefit card offering discounted rates at Accor properties worldwide.
- Learning programs through Accor Academies with opportunities to earn professional qualifications.
- Career growth within the property and international mobility within Accor\'s global network.
- Opportunity to contribute to local community initiatives through Accor’s Corporate Social Responsibility programs, including Planet 21.
- A supportive and inclusive work environment that encourages diversity and professional development.
